The Lighthouse for the Blind, Inc.
Job Announcement
Title: Surplus Sales Coordinator
Reports to: Materials Manager
Hours: Part Time, 20 hours/week (flex)
Job Summary:
To carry out direct sales and marketing activities and to develop
alternate channels to sell, liquidate or dispose of excess inventories.
Job Duties
a.. Conduct market and technology research to identify most effective
distribution methods.
b.. Plan and prioritize sales activities and customer/prospect
contact.
c.. Plan and conduct promotional activities as needed.
d.. Leverage existing infrastructure and processes. (e.g. LH WEB
sites)
e.. Identify, evaluate and present opportunities with outside
organizations.
f.. Identify, research and present opportunities with industry and
other pertinent publications.
g.. Work closely with Materials and other departments to identify and
prioritize excess/surplus products.
h.. Work with Marketing/sales personnel to share leads/collaborate on
specified sales project.
i.. Respond to and follow up on sales inquires.
j.. Develop and implement appropriate measurement to assess program
effectiveness.
General Qualifications
a.. Some success with a selling experience (Not more than 2 years as
this is a starting role)
b.. Experience in cold calling, prospecting and qualifying leads
preferred.
c.. Strong written and verbal communication skills
d.. Creative, has initiative and can constructively navigate mine
fields.
e.. Strong familiarity with e-commerce's competitive landscape
preferred.
f.. Experience in a high-tech/e-commerce environment
g.. Familiarity with Liquidators or Over-Stock programs and sources a
strong plus.
